PHA 자극-DNCB 감작토끼 임파구가 Ehrlich Carcinoma의 피하이식암 성장에 미치는 영향

Kim and Kim(1970) in our laboratory reported that the immunotherapy against subaxillary implanted mice of Ehrlich carcinoma with immune lymphocytes from rabbits immunized with live or UV-killed Ehrlich carcinoma showed not only tumor regression but also prolongation of survival of mice bearing tumors. Lee and Kim(1970) also demonstrated lymphocytes from rabbits immunized with the same tumors have a powerful cytocidal effect on target cells in vitro. And they suggested that the immunity of Ehrlich carcinoma is mediated by cell-mediated immune reaction. It is a well known fact that dinitrochlorobenzene (DNCB) induces delayed hypersensitivity and phytohemagglutinin (PHA) stimulates the transformation of small lymphocytes in vitro. And that Brostoff et al. (1969) demonstrated that the lymphocytes that respond to non-specific stimuli such as PHA was almost all thymus-dependent cells (T-lymphocytes) which may produce and secrete a soluble factor that nonspecifically stimulates the transformation of the lymphocytes. We made an attempt to observe the tumoricidal activity of PHA-stimulated thoracic lymphocytes from DNCB-sensitized rabbits by means of administration of them into Ehrlich solid tumor bearing mice. The results were as follows: PHA-stimulated thoracic lymphocytes from DNCB-sensitized rabbits were no effective in tumoricidal activity.
INTEGRAL REPRESENTATIONS FOR SRIVASTAVA'S HYPERGEOMETRIC FUNCTION HB

While investigating the Lauricella's list of 14 complete second-order hypergeometric series in three variables, Srivastava noticed the existence of three additional complete triple hypergeometric series of the second order, which were denoted by HA, HB and HC. Each of these three triple hypergeometric functions HA, HB and HC has been investigated extensively in many di®erent ways including,for example, in the problem of ¯nding their integral representations of one kind or the other. Here, in this paper, we aim at presenting further integral representations for the Srivatava's triple hypergeometric function HB.
CERTAIN INTEGRAL REPRESENTATIONS OF EULER TYPE FOR THE EXTON FUNCTION X5

Exton introduced 20 distinct triple hypergeometric func-tions whose names are Xi (i = 1,..., 20) to investigate their twenty Laplace integral representations whose kernels include the conflu-ent hypergeometric functions 0F1, 1F1, a Humbert function ψ2, a Humbert function Φ2. The object of this paper is to present 25 (pre-sumably new) integral representations of Euler types for the Exton hypergeometric function X5 among his twenty Xi (i = 1,..., 20),whose kernels include the Exton function X5 itself, the Exton func-tion X6, the Horn's functions H3 and H4, and the hypergeometric function F = 2F1.
APPELL'S FUNCTION F1 AND EXTON'S TRIPLE HYPERGEOMETRIC FUNCTION X9

In the theory of hypergeometric functions of one or several variables,a remarkable amount of mathematicians's concern has been given to develop their transformation formulas and summation identities. Here we aim at presenting ex-plicit expressions (in a single form) of the following weighted Appell's function F_1:(1 + 2x)^-a (1 + 2z)^-b F1(c, a, b ; 2c + j ;4x/(1 + 2x),4z/(1 + 2z)(j = 0;±1,...,±5)in terms of Exton's triple hypergeometric X_9. The results are derived with the help of generalizations of Kummer's second theorem very recently provided by Kim et al. A large number of very interesting special cases including Exton's result are also given.
Certain new integral formulas involving the generalized Bessel functions

A remarkably large number of integral formulas involving a variety of special functions have been developed by many authors. Also many integral formulas involving various Bessel functions have been pre- sented. Very recently, Choi and Agarwal derived two generalized integral formulas associated with the Bessel function J(z) of the first kind, which are expressed in terms of the generalized (Wright) hypergeometric func- tions. In the present sequel to Choi and Agarwal’s work, here, in this paper, we establish two new integral formulas involving the generalized Bessel functions, which are also expressed in terms of the generalized (Wright) hypergeometric functions. Some interesting special cases of our two main results are presented. We also point out that the results pre- sented here, being of general character, are easily reducible to yield many diverse new and known integral formulas involving simpler functions.

Further log-sine and log-cosine integrals

Motivated essentially by their potential for applications in a wide range of mathematical and physical problems, the log-sine and log-cosine integrals have been evaluated, in the existing literature on the subject, in many di®erent ways. Very recently,Choi [6] presented explicit evaluations of some families of log-sine and log-cosine integrals by making use of the familiar Beta function. In the present sequel to the investigation [6], we evaluate the log-sine and log-cosine integrals involved in more complicated integrands than those in [6], by also using the Beta function.

EVALUATION OF CERTAIN ALTERNATING SERIES

Ever since Euler solved the so-called Basler problem of ζ(2) = Σ∞n=1 1/n2, numerous evaluations of ζ(2n) (n ∈ N) as well as ζ(2) have been presented. Very recently, Ritelli [61] used a double integral to evaluate ζ(2). Modifying mainly Ritelli's double integral, here, we aim at evaluating certain interesting alternating series.
